Obito Uchiha: "But a world of just victors, peace and love... such a world can be created too." Details: Obito wishes to create world without suffering. A world filled without pain. And last challenge my body was in a lot of pain. Mostly because I don't get flexible and don't stretch after beatdowns like Kickboxing. So its' time for me to stretch! I need to stretch at least 5 minutes after I do kickboxing, which is about 2 to 3 times a week. Every workout needs to end with a way to get rid of pain. Contingencies: No Contigencies. Stretching needs to be after every workout, including kickboxing, so after I do a kickboxing session at Easton, I'll be doing stretches that same night! Tracking: I'll be tracking the stretching sessions using MyFitnessPal ( username BlackTezca ) with the workout listed as "yoga" or "pilates" and this lovely thread will be updated as well. Grading: A for extra stretching session for at least 5 minutes three times a week ( 2 Dex 1 Con ) B for extra stretching for at least 5 minutes twice a week ( 2 Dex ) C for extra stretching for at least 5 minutes once a week ( 1 Dex ) F for all else Ursula: "Now I am the ruler of all the ocean!   3. I'm thinking about starting a small business to provide paleo families with a quick and easy way to enjoy pancakes (one of my pre-paleo favorites). The mix I make would require less than 3 ingrediants from your kitchen and less than 10 minutes to make. It's like Bisquick, but better tasting and without any of that processed junk. The recipe I use includes coconut flour, almond flour, arrowroot powder, tapioca flour, and baking soda. All of these are healthy and paleo. I know not every paleo nerd loves to bake as much as I do, so this would be a way for other people to enjoy some of their favorite foods that they've had to give up. I always felt excluded when my non-paleo family ate pancakes, does anyone else have a similar situation? Now with this mix, I can quickly whip up some paleo pancakes and boom! I'm part of the family. So yay or nay to a paleo pancake mix?

  6. Note: inspired by the chunky monkey muffins from the book Paleo cravings, with my own modifications. These are amazing if you're looking for something different for breakfast! 1 cup tapioca flour (you can substitute up to 1/4 of coconut flour for this) 1 tsp baking soda 1/2 cup butter 1 1/2 tbsp honey (more or less depending on personal taste) 1 medium to large banana 1 tsp vanilla 4 eggs 3/4 bar 86 dark chocolate, chopped 1 cup walnuts Mix dry and wet ingredients separately, then combine. Add chocolate and walnuts. Put into a muffin tin and bake at 350 degrees for about 20 - 25 minutes. Makes 12 muffins. Per 1 muffin: 241 calories, 13.25 g fat, 12.6 g carbs, 4.37 g protein. Enjoy!
